    Some background on Girls Rock! Ri, the Providence fundraiser beneficiary:

    ABOUT Girls Rock! Rhode Island (GRR!)
    >>MISSION
    The mission of Girls Rock! Rhode Island is to help girls and women empower themselves through the development of musical skills in order to foster self-esteem, self-confidence, and self-efficacy. Through this work we hope to build an environment conducive to the active participation and respect of women as creative producers of our culture. We envision a future where women and girls are prolific, independent creators of all aspects of modern culture.
    >>GIRLS ROCK CAMP
    The first Girls Rock Camp(s) was held in Rhode Island in July of 2010. Girls Rock Camp is an intensive one-week day camp offered to girls ages 11-18, where campers of all skill levels have the opportunity to learn guitar, bass, drums, vocals, or other instruments. Campers will also form a band, write an original song, and perform at the final Showcase for friends, family, and fans!
    In addition to all this, campers will have the opportunity to meet other girls, female musicians and mentors, and participate in enrichment activities that may include screen-printing, self-defense, body image/self-esteem, media literacy, concert/show promotion, songwriting, and women in rock history. GRR! welcomes campers that identify as female, trans, and gender-nonconforming.
    >>LADIES ROCK CAMP
    With the firm belief that it’s never too late to rock, Ladies Rock Camp is held twice per year. In three short days, women 18 and up can learn guitar, bass, drums, vocals, as well as form bands, write original songs, and perform at a Showcase. All skill levels are welcome. Ladies will have the opportunity to mix and mingle with other Lady Campers and professional female musicians, as well as learn about rad topics like concert/show promotion, screen-printing, women in rock history, and self-defense. The proceeds from Ladies Rock Camp help to support Girls Rock Camp! You can find more information about Ladies Rock Camp here.
    >>GIRLS GET LOUD
    Girls Get Loud is GRR!'s after-school program. GGL takes the elements of Girls Rock Camp and spreads them out throughout the school year-- learning instruments, writing songs, and more! Currently, GGL is funded through the Providence After School Alliance and is available to middle school students in Providence only, but we hope that additional funding will allow us to provide GGL to more girls in the future!
    >>LADIES ROCK LAB
    Ladies Rock Lab is a big, fun jam session open to ladies 18+ who want to rock out with other awesome women in a positive and supportive environment! LRL happens on the first Friday of every month at JamStage.
